Extract the folder contained in this zip file into your *\World of Warcraft* folder. When the game runs it will substitute any sounds it finds there for equivalent sounds in the game. Do not use the Curse Client Auto-installer . It is a known problem that it does not handle sound mod addons properly.

The mod linked is in fact unsupported as of this day, August 17, 2019. You will notice in the instructional video that the old directory structure is used, and not the current structure with \World of Warcraft_retail_ and \World of Warcraft_classic_ folders. Putting the sound folder in retail has no effect. If the downloaded sounds can be made to work then the exact means are not described in the post at curseforge or the linked video.
